A Look at CMC Markets

CMC Markets is a widely recognized and popular UK-based broker, established in 1989. And offers more than 10,000 trading instruments across traditional CFD assets, and fully developed spread betting solutions.

This is an online trading platform established in 1989. It provides services in Forex and CFD trading, with an asset portfolio of more than 10,000 instruments. It is regulated and listed on the London Stock Exchange and is a member of the FTSE Smallcap Index. CMC Markets is trusted globally and provides services to retail traders and institutional clients such as brokers, banks, trading desks, and hedge funds. It offers liquidity rebates of up to 5% for active traders and a Next Generation trading platform with quality research, powerful charting, and innovative trading tools.

CMC Markets Regulations and Licenses

This broker is regulated by various financial bodies across the world, such as:

  • The UK Financial Conduct Authority (FCA).
  • Investment Industry Regulatory Organization of Canada (IIROC).
  • Australian Securities and Investment Commission (ASIC).
  • Financial Markets Authority (FMA) of New Zealand.
  • Monetary Authority of Singapore (MAS).

Products Offered By CMC Markets

CMC Markets offers a range of Contracts for Difference (CFDs) for a variety of financial assets but does not provide trading for stocks, bonds, options, or futures. And, the selection of currency pairs available makes it a great choice for forex traders.

  • 338 currency pairs
  • 92 stock index CFDs
  • 8,000 stock CFDs
  • 1,000 ETF CFDs
  • 136 commodity CFDs
  • 56 bond CFDs
  • 15 cryptocurrencies
